Output 684e3a3bbef3cfd84992864514cf6c5528fd9a7a6f722d5061bd2f7054948e02:4

value
1197026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 789cd5ab8454c0c19a435862c9fbb88714a0013a OP_EQUAL
address
3CgktdFVDhepom5KdEcLWwK4iZzt7CtNus
transaction
684e3a3bbef3cfd84992864514cf6c5528fd9a7a6f722d5061bd2f7054948e02
confirmations
155429
spent
true